Job Description

This position is onsite in Rochester, NY. No 3rd party agencies. Must be able to work on W2 without sponsorship. In this role, you will manage and mentor Project Managers, oversee project performance, and directly manage select projects while ensuring the successful delivery of transportation projects for clients such as NYSDOT and local municipalities. You will set direction, balance workloads, support professional development, and ensure projects are delivered on time, on budget, and in alignment with client expectations. Responsibilities Lead and grow a collaborative, high-performing team aligned with the firm s mission, values, and commitment to design excellence. Provide hands-on leadership that empowers Project Managers, supports professional development, and fosters accountability and engagement across locations. Position the Infrastructure + Mobility group for long-term success through strong team morale, consistent performance, and sustainable growth. Oversee transportation projects, ensuring clear priorities and delivery on time, on budget, aligned with scope and quality expectations. Effectively manage project financials, staffing, and schedules while proactively resolving technical, schedule, or budget challenges. Serve as primary client contact, building trusted relationships and delivering exceptional service to public and private sector clients. Contribute to business planning and proactively drive new work with existing and prospective clients. Lead proposal development and participate in interviews, promoting our client's design capabilities and market presence. Mentor, coach, and set expectations for staff while supporting performance and career development. Navigate and support complex public processes and municipal approvals related to transportation projects. Represent our client in professional organizations and community activities to strengthen visibility and industry relationships. Qualifications B.S. degree in Civil Engineering or related field (Master s preferred) 15+ years minimum in transportation, roadway, or highway engineering Professional Engineering License (PE) 5 years of minimum project management experience Strong financial acumen, with the ability to use dashboards, metrics, and data to drive performance, accountability, and results. Familiarity with NYSD OT design standards required Prior experience successfully managing and leading a team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ills Proven client relationship and business development success in the transportation sector Proficiency in MS Office; Experience with MicroStation preferred Professional performance standards aligned with our client's Mission, Vision, and Core Values Dedicated to fostering trusting relationships through collaboration, integrity, respect, and active listening Proven ability to deliver quality work through critical thinking, problem-solving, and sound judgment Driven to own projects, prioritize effectively, and thrive in a fast-paced, growth-focused environment Superior organizational and planning skills with keen attention to detail Highly adaptable and proactive in meeting deliverables and deadlines Curious, improvement-minded, and always seeking better solutions Embrace feedback constructively and use it as an opportunity for growth
